Of Vulgar Fractions.

RITHMETIC is the Art of numbering. Every Thing, therefore, which may be numbered, is the Subject of Arithmetic. Hence, not only Integers, or whole Things, but their feveral Parts, are brought into arithmetical Computation; fince all Things are, or may be fuppofed, divifible into any Number of equal Parts.

Some Things are, for Convenience in Commerce, by Custom divided into Parts, which have a particular Denomination: As a Pound Sterling is divided into 20 Shillings, a Shilling into 12 Pence, and a Penny into 4 Farthings: A Foot is divided into Inches, and an Inch into Quarters and Half-Quarters; and the like of other Things. But it often happens, that Integers are divided into Parts, which have no particular Denomination, but are denominated only from the Number, by which the Integer is divided. Thus any Integer (as a Pound Sterling, for Example) may be fuppofed to be divided into 5, 13, 28, 57, or any other Number of equal Parts ; which can only be denominated from the Number by which the Integer is divided, and called a fifth, a thirteenth, a twenty-eighth, a fifty-feventh Part of a Pound, or whatever is thus divided.

In arithmetical Calculations, it often happens, that Integers are divided into different Parts; and a Number of thofe Parts are required to be taken, which generally are lefs than the Number of Parts into which the Integer is divided. Thus a Pound Sterling may be divided into 36 Parts, and it may be required to take 19 of thofe Parts; which are called nineteen Thirty-fixths of a Pound. Again, if a Pound Sterling, or any other Integer, be divided into 17 Parts, and I of those Parts are required to be taken, this is called eleven Seventeenths of a Pound, or whatever elfe is fuppofed to be thus divided. These are what are ufually called Fractions, or the fractional Parts of Things. But, as it is frequently neceffary to bring those fractional Parts into Calculations, a Method has been invented to express them in Figures: The Way of doing which is next to be fhewn.

Of the Notation of Fractions, and their feveral Kinds.

A Fraction, otherwife called a broken Number, is that by which the Parts of Things are expreffed. Thus, if we were to exprefs three Farthings, a Farthing being the Fourth of a Penny, three Farthings are three Fourths of a Penny; which must be wrote thus, . A vulgar Fraction always confifts of two Parts, that is, two Numbers, fet one over the other, with a Line drawn betwixt them. To exprefs any Number of Inches in Foot-Meafure, as feven Inches, you must put down 7, and 12 under it, with a Line betwixt, as; which is to be read, feven Twelfths of a Foot, an Inch being the twelfth Part of a Foot. If a Foot, a Pound Sterling, or any other Thing, were to be divided into 100 equal Parts, in order to exprefs 32 of thofe Parts by a Fraction, write them thus, , that is, thirty-two Hundredth-Parts of a Foot, Pound, or whatever was fuppofed to be divided. And the Number above the Line is called the Numerator, that below the Denominator: Thus, in the Fraction above-mentioned,, the 7 is the Numerator, and the 12 the Denominator: So in this, five Seventeenths, 5 is the Numerator, and 17 the Denominator.
